- 1st October 1997On a histogram, a 5-wide bar and a 20-wide bar have the same frequency density of 3. How many more values are in the wider class?
- 2nd October 1997Simplify sqrt(75) + sqrt(12), giving your answer in the form a sqrt(b).
- 3rd October 1997A quadratic sequence starts 9, 18, 33, 54. Work out the second difference, and the coefficient of n^2.
- 4th October 1997y is directly proportional to x^3. When x = 4, y = 256. Work out y when x = 2.
- 5th October 1997In a vector proof you find that vector PQ = 4a - 4b and vector RS = 8a - 8b. What does this show about PQ and RS?
- 6th October 1997A bag holds 8 red and n blue counters. The probability of taking a red is 2/3. Work out n.
- 7th October 1997A histogram has two bars: one 10 units wide with frequency density 2, one 5 units wide with density 3. How many values in total?
- 8th October 1997A rectangle is 27 cm by 19 cm, each correct to the nearest cm. Work out the upper bound of its area.
- 9th October 1997Solve x^2 - 8x + 12 < 0.
- 10th October 1997y is directly proportional to sqrt(x). When x = 4, y = 10. Work out y when x = 25.
- 11th October 1997A cuboid measures 6 cm by 5 cm by 4 cm. Work out the length of the longest diagonal inside it, to 1 decimal place.
- 12th October 1997A bag holds 7 red and 3 blue counters. Two are taken without replacement. Given the first was red, what is the probability the second is blue?
- 13th October 1997On a histogram, a 10-wide bar and a 30-wide bar have the same frequency density of 2. How many more values are in the wider class?
- 14th October 1997Expand and simplify (6 + sqrt(3))(6 - sqrt(3)).
- 15th October 1997Write x^2 - 12x + 7 in the form (x + a)^2 + b.
- 16th October 1997A train slows steadily from 37 m/s to rest in 5 seconds. Work out its deceleration.
- 17th October 1997A cuboid measures 6 cm by 13 cm by 6 cm tall. Work out the angle between its longest internal diagonal and the base, to 1 decimal place.
- 18th October 1997A bag holds 7 red, 3 blue and 4 green counters. Two are taken without replacement. Given neither is green, what is the probability both are red?
- 19th October 1997A histogram has two bars: one 20 units wide with frequency density 1.5, one 20 units wide with density 1.4. How many values in total?
- 20th October 1997A block has mass 380 g (to the nearest 10 g) and volume 14 cm^3 (to the nearest cm^3). Work out the upper bound of its density, to 2 decimal places.
- 21st October 1997Work out the coordinates of the turning point of y = x^2 - 16x + 5.
- 22nd October 1997y is inversely proportional to x^2. When x = 3, y = 48. Work out y when x = 4.
- 23rd October 1997The point (5, 12) lies on the circle x^2 + y^2 = 169. Work out the gradient of the tangent to the circle at that point.
- 24th October 1997A bag holds 8 counters, r of them red. Two are taken without replacement and P(both red) = 3/14. Work out r.
- 25th October 1997On a histogram, a 4-wide bar and a 16-wide bar have the same frequency density of 2. How many more values are in the wider class?
- 26th October 1997x = 171 and y = 28, each correct to the nearest whole number. Work out the upper bound of x - y.
- 27th October 1997Simplify (x^2 - 9x + 14)/(x - 7).
- 28th October 1997y is directly proportional to x^3. When x = 4, y = 384. Work out y when x = 5.
- 29th October 1997In a circle theorem proof, a step uses the fact that the three angles of triangle OAB are being summed. State the reason being quoted.
- 30th October 1997The probability of winning a game is 1/8. A player expects 15 wins. How many games did they play?
- 31st October 1997A histogram has two bars: one 20 units wide with frequency density 2, one 20 units wide with density 1.4. How many values in total?
